Nexus created by installing a POD app....how?

Hello.

I manage a number of Shopify stores for authors and most of them use a company called BookVault to fulfill paperback orders. BookVault is a POD vendor, meaning that when an order comes through, they print the order immediately. They then fulfill and ship the order directly to the customer. No stocking or inventory involved. They have fulfillment locations in the US (Ohio), UK, Canada and Australia.

To make this work there is a BookVault App that is installed on each Shopify store to “link” the store to BookVault for order fulfillment. This creates the links and an appropriate shipping profile in each store.

In the last month, EVERY single store that I manage (dozens) that has the BookVault app installed, and have US fulfillment enabled have suddenly reached Nexus in Ohio according to Shopify. Every…single…one. I’ve run reports on every store and none of them have reached either the order number or order value threshold for nexus in Ohio.

It’s interesting because this seems to align with BookVault deploying and update to their app…and their US location is in Ohio.

Here’s my question. Can a customer using an app/POD vendor actually have nexus in the state in question even though they haven’t reached the nexus requirement? Can the vendor’s location and nexus status impact the nexus status of the Shopify store?

None of the other POD vendors our clients work with seem to do this.
